Groundbreaking study aims to unlock secrets of maternal health in somaliland
NCT ID NCT07438379
Summary
This study aims to understand the physical, cultural, and emotional challenges women in Somaliland face during pregnancy and after childbirth. Researchers will follow about 800 pregnant women through their pregnancy and postpartum period, collecting information through questionnaires and health measurements. The findings will be used to co-create better health education and contraceptive counseling materials tailored to the local community.
